WINCHESTER, Mass. – The Bentley men's tennis team returned to Northeast-10 action Saturday, hosting Southern New Hampshire at the Winchester Tennis Club. The Falcons fell to the Penmen, 6-1. Bentley's previous four matches were against NCAA D-I teams.
Rafael Cueto accounted for Bentley's lone victory against SNHU, and he did it in comeback style on the No. 2 singles court. Cueto lost the first set, 6-1, but then stormed back to win the next two sets, each a score of 6-4.
The Falcons are slated for four matches this coming week, starting with UMass Boston Monday, April 14, in Waltham.
